> You don't mention the tires. Vibration that is unrelated to the BRAKES
> (note spelling) is usually the tires. They are one or more of these: badly
> mounted, feathered, cupped, out-of-true or out-of-round.
>
> Is there a steering wheel wobble when you accelerate slowly from extremely
> low speeds?
>
> A vibration at the highway speeds you mention that happens ONLY upon
> acceleration can be worn inner CV joints. Severely worn OUTER joints can
> also cause this symptom, but such joints would emit a heavy
> clunkclunkclunk
> as you rounded corners.
